Prescription drug addiction is now one of the nation’s most serious drug problems. Colvin is also the author of two other nonfiction books.. Rod Colvin understands this problem. He has appeared on various national, regional, and local broadcasts. His 35-year old brother died as a result of his long-term addiction to painkillers and tranquilizers. Drawing from his personal experience and his background as a counselor, Colvin offers help to those suffering from addiction as well as their families.
